Course Content

• Media Ethics Foundations: Defining principles, theories, and frameworks relevant to media responsibility.
• Media Law and Regulation: Exploring legal aspects impacting ethical decision-making in media, including defamation, privacy, and intellectual property.
• Responsible Reporting and Journalism Ethics: Focusing on accuracy, fairness, impartiality, and avoiding harm in news gathering and dissemination.
• Digital Media Ethics: Examining unique ethical challenges posed by social media, online platforms, and the digital landscape; including misinformation and disinformation.
• Advertising and Marketing Ethics: Analyzing ethical considerations in advertising, public relations, and marketing communications, covering issues like transparency and consumer protection.
• Media Diversity and Inclusion: Addressing representation, bias, and stereotypes in media content and the importance of promoting diverse voices.
• Media Accountability and Transparency: Exploring mechanisms for holding media organizations accountable, including self-regulation and external oversight.
• Crisis Communication and Ethical Responses: Managing ethical dilemmas during crisis situations, considering public trust and stakeholder relations.
